What is biomimicry?
Biomimicry, also known as biomimetics or biomimetic design, is a transformative approach that draws inspiration from nature’s intricate designs, complex mechanisms and unmatched efficiency. This multidisciplinary methodology seeks to emulate biological processes, structures and functions found in various living organisms, unlocking a wealth of innovative solutions to address human challenges.
By closely observing and studying nature’s sophisticated designs, biomimicry aims to adapt and apply these principles to human-made systems, technologies and products. The goal is to develop sustainable and highly effective solutions that align with the principles of natural ecosystems, seeking to minimise negative impacts on the environment and fostering harmony between human activities and the natural world.
Biomimicry spans diverse fields, including engineering, architecture, materials science, medicine and more, offering the potential for groundbreaking innovations in various industries. As we face the complex challenges of climate change, population growth and resource scarcity, biomimicry could pave a sustainable and resilient path forward.
